Join a dynamic, family-centered labor and delivery unit. Every day
offers variety and meaningful patient connections. Nurses provide
comprehensive care to mothers and newborns throughout labor,
delivery, recovery, and the postpartum period. This assignment is
ideal for adaptable, skilled nurses who thrive in a fast-paced,
team-oriented environment. Key responsibilities include providing
care for laboring, delivering, and postpartum mothers and their
newborns in a combined setting. Manage continuous fetal monitoring
and assist with both vaginal and cesarean deliveries. Deliver
immediate newborn care, support breastfeeding, and provide patient
education. Handle antepartum admissions, post-delivery recovery,
and newborn nursery assessments. Collaborate closely with
providers, anesthesia, lactation consultants, and support staff.
Complete accurate documentation, discharge teaching, and patient
follow-up education. The ideal candidate is proactive and confident
in caring for both mothers and newborns. Strong communication
skills and the ability to remain calm under pressure are crucial.
The candidate should be passionate about patient education and
supporting families during a life-changing experience.
Unpredictable patient volumes and high-acuity cases require
flexibility and quick critical thinking. Nurses may float between
labor, delivery, postpartum, and nursery areas. The department aims
to provide safe, compassionate, and family-centered care for
mothers and infants. Support is provided through clear orientation
and guidance to ensure a smooth transition into unit protocols.
